Pros & Cons

The AI used to provide these results are constantly improving. These results might change.

Pros

The scalloped serrations of this knife are very sharp and work well. It breaks through crusty bread well, so long as you use light back and forth pressure first, until you break through the crust and the serrations start to grab, then proceed with nor...  Read More

The knife is very solid and comes in a nice lined case for storage, but we don't use it, as our knife drawer has a slotted wooden insert. It is also heavy enough to feel solid in my grip.

This knife is awesome! I find this knife to work very well. Highly recommend. Everyone loves it.



Cons

It generates a lot of crumbs. I have to squish my bread so hard to even get this knife to * the crust.

It looks beatiful but is too slick. This eliminates any pleasure from having this new bread knife. Am super sad they did not consider adding texture to the handle to support petite ladies like myself what are not butch and muscular. Didn't compare to ...  Read More
